East Side Neighborhood Associations Announce Wisconsin Assembly 19th District Candidate Forum on July 20
Democratic primary Aug. 11 to determine who advances to the general election Nov. 3
MILWAUKEE, WI — July 14, 2026 — Five East Side neighborhood associations will co-host a Democratic primary election candidate forum for the Wisconsin State Assembly’s 19th District on Monday July 20 from 6:30 p.m. to 8 p.m. at St. Mark’s Church, 2618 N. Hackett Avenue, with a live virtual attendance option available for the public.
The forum offers Milwaukee voters a direct opportunity to hear from incumbent Ryan Clancy and challenger Bridget Maniaci before the primary election on Tuesday Aug. 11. The primary winner will advance to the Nov. 3 general election to represent the 19th District in Madison.
Jeramey Jannene, President of Urban Milwaukee, will moderate the 90-minute event. Candidates will address pre-selected questions on key state and district policy issues under strict time constraints. To ensure a structured format, only the candidates and the moderator will speak during the formal program. Attendees will have an opportunity to meet the candidates face-to-face immediately following the forum’s conclusion.
The 19th Assembly District encompasses downtown Milwaukee, the Historic Third Ward, the University of Wisconsin–Milwaukee campus, a portion of Bay View, and the Jackson Street and Garfield Avenue corridors.
The event is organized and sponsored by the Murray Hill Neighborhood Association, Historic Water Tower Neighborhood, Cambridge Woods Neighborhood Association, Mariners Neighborhood Association MKE and the East Bank Neighborhood Association.
